Output d934bdce71deefc0ecbf0a1c94d061d7cd55e6e2f9d605ee94992f94c8280573:1

value
365145911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d84c4dc28e6fc9842171545afa39a8a48e2d9f4 OP_EQUAL
address
3MtJJtWy3PC2ZY8jUkpDiz4fP3UkC2rKKV
transaction
d934bdce71deefc0ecbf0a1c94d061d7cd55e6e2f9d605ee94992f94c8280573